Incident Summary:

05/22/2013: Gunmen attacked an army patrol in the rural area of Chitaga, Norte de Santander department, Colombia. Eleven soldiers were killed, six others were wounded, and two individuals were kidnapped following the attack. The body of one of the kidnapping victims was later found by security forces. The second kidnapping victim was released July 4, 2013. The National Liberation Army of Colombia (ELN) claimed responsibility for the incident.
